Transaction 0585891ebaa17ecb87352749841ca262d86a8135d99e46599a325d42e528d540
1 Input
1 Output
-
0585891ebaa17ecb87352749841ca262d86a8135d99e46599a325d42e528d540:0
- value
- 524662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e78dfa3f057b8dad1f335edc58cfa5cc7dd3a630 OP_EQUAL
- address
- 3NoN6dNWAioUxqizJZoSjvP969RzLkm9Ja